Sleater-kinney
The Center Won't Hold (indie)
Indie version is 180 gram vinyl plus bonus 7" single and collectible artpack.
"How does brokenness walk? Or move through the world?" says guitarist/vocalist Carrie Brownstein about The Center Won't
Hold, Sleater-Kinney's tenth studio album. "We're always mixing the personal and the political but on this record,
despite obviously thinking so much about politics, we were really thinking about the person - ourselves or versions of
ourselves or iterations of depression or loneliness - in the middle of the chaos." The Center Won't Hold is
Sleater-Kinney's midnight record on the doomsday clock. After twenty-five years of legendary collaboration, rock'n'roll
giants Brownstein, Corin Tucker, and Janet Weiss rise to meet the moment by digging deeper and sounding bigger than
we've heard them yet. Here are intimate battle cries. Here are shattered songs for the shattered survivors. The Center
Won't Hold drops you into the world of catastrophe that touches on the election," says guitarist/vocalist Tucker of the
title track. "We're not taking it easy on the audience. That song is meant to be really heavy and dark. And almost like
a mission statement, at the end of that song, it's like we're finding our way out of that space by becoming a rock band.
